From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p1 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id qPA2Nbf3lmCpZwEAgWs5BA (envelope-from ) for ; Sat, 08 May 2021 22:42:31 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p1 with LMTPS id +Ni3MLf3lmDXeQAAbx9fmQ (envelope-from ) for ; Sat, 08 May 2021 20:42:31 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id 674D417450 for ; Sat, 8 May 2021 22:42:31 +0200 (CEST) Received: from localhost ([::1]:38956 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1lfTmP-0000ZY-Ve for larch@yhetil.org; Sat, 08 May 2021 16:42:29 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:44642)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1lfTlz-0000ZH-Qx for guix-patches@gnu.org; Sat, 08 May 2021 16:42:04 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:40624)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1lfTlz-0007Ku-1t for guix-patches@gnu.org; Sat, 08 May 2021 16:42:03 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1lfTlz-0005Hc-0A for guix-patches@gnu.org; Sat, 08 May 2021 16:42:03 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#48296] [PATCH 1/1] gnu: Add python-sqlalchemy-stubs. Resent-From: BonfaceKilz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Sat, 08 May 2021 20:42: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 48296 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 48296@debbugs.gnu.org Cc: BonfaceKilz X-Debbugs-Original-To: guix-patches@gnu.org Received: via spool by submit@debbugs.gnu.org id=B.162050651020285 (code B ref -1); Sat, 08 May 2021 20:42:02 +0000 Received: (at submit) by debbugs.gnu.org; 8 May 2021 20:41:50 +0000 Received: from localhost ([127.0.0.1]:52167 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1lfTll-0005H7-ID for submit@debbugs.gnu.org; Sat, 08 May 2021 16:41:49 -0400 Received: from lists.gnu.org ([209.51.188.17]:40560)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1lfTlh-0005H1-UR for submit@debbugs.gnu.org; Sat, 08 May 2021 16:41:48 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:44638)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1lfTlh-0000Yo-Ml for guix-patches@gnu.org; Sat, 08 May 2021 16:41:45 -0400 Received: from wout3-smtp.messagingengine.com ([64.147.123.19]:47677)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1lfTlf-00078h-AV for guix-patches@gnu.org; Sat, 08 May 2021 16:41:45 -0400 Received: from compute1.internal (compute1.nyi.internal [10.202.2.41]) by mailout.west.internal (Postfix) with ESMTP id 435FC1668; Sat, 8 May 2021 16:41:41 -0400 (EDT) Received: from mailfrontend1 ([10.202.2.162]) by compute1.internal (MEProxy); Sat, 08 May 2021 16:41:41 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= bonfacemunyoki.com; h=from:to:cc:subject:date:message-id :in-reply-to:references:mime-version:content-type :content-transfer-encoding; s=fm2; bh=Rp9bi8kFI3nw4zfK035oQgYfbu uaAHuez/7Is2nSRPw=; b=Xbp/I3YtkD11LhOB/Kkk3CtBaS/Nu3t+2K0xCRtXa6 btk/VDPyrfcwxKOdJGJRUE35+0+8NimeIB7Efpw8JA2eIJpV5CcB1Iiqlisg7LPj fYdFEFATVDUJk/w+1mTbwvRvyUpa8Z2fvwzRgivZICWsCqLHopz98R6zqr33A2oS JxFrJoL7esDp83MxE2mEoBTRflIq11dT6VxHAEfuRZHuVM7eYIwgenDuiYYoBA4r acRpIYfDbTUBcirohIoobfzR3VrDdQzqeUZ+WdvfRgkhJRCIXQ+iQGQh/UEBAZm2 SxtTsae92uauvWLSaLPYPoh2zmVqdB1Lwba1Nt55D9vA==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-transfer-encoding:content-type :date:from:in-reply-to:message-id:mime-version:references :subject:to:x-me-proxy:x-me-proxy:x-me-sender:x-me-sender :x-sasl-enc; s=fm2; bh=Rp9bi8kFI3nw4zfK035oQgYfbuuaAHuez/7Is2nSR Pw=; b=R/4mFNT+1s1OYOu+cJ9rbwCed3okehJMaADZG4hj6fVE28lnGLvu4l+AT E1M/4Dmycl2/CauJzXM8xEmFRr5LOlqEcyQxXSTeyzbklMfDaKdksNitU8AhlB+Q u0+m5V6jsAZjEG6NbC0wx7MwtzPn/T3XIqhPodAdqUpO3n/W/9aGeIyh1TSfjP9Q rIDhoGGHMUYhmgwT8Nx5H9EUwOJvHx2WNineEgmjBjfYwMCkjA3NTEAe91CiBvry x8OzUPg5IqAG8/EMiiJQs+5j/t1kSTymVrqPsCghqiTmkkf5tks1+/A/Rk4JKSBo DtXgd8tj52771EfJY9oJNrmJJyQtg== X-ME-Sender: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eduledrvdeggedgudehiecutefuodetggdotefrod ftvfcurfhrohhfihhlvgemucfhrghsthforghilhdpqfgfvfdpuffrtefokffrpgfnqfgh necuuegrihhlohhuthemuceftddtnecufghrlhcuvffnffculddvfedmnecujfgurhephf fvufffkffojghfgggtgfesthekredtredtjeenucfhrhhomhepuehonhhfrggtvgfmihhl iicuoehmvgessghonhhfrggtvghmuhhnhihokhhirdgtohhmqeenucggtffrrghtthgvrh hnpeettdfggfekudfgueehudeivdefudekhedtfefgueefveevkedvueejieeuheffkeen ucffohhmrghinhepghhithhhuhgsrdgtohhmnecukfhppeeguddrkedtrdejiedrheegne cuveh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omhepmhgvsegs ohhnfhgrtggvmhhunhihohhkihdrtghomh X-ME-Proxy: Received: from localhost.localdomain (unknown [41.80.76.54]) by mail.messagingengine.com (Postfix) with ESMTPA; Sat, 8 May 2021 16:41:39 -0400 (EDT) From: BonfaceKilz Date: Sat, 8 May 2021 23:41:24 +0300 Message-Id: <20210508204124.38500-2-me@bonfacemunyoki.com> X-Mailer: git-send-email 2.31.1 In-Reply-To: <20210508204124.38500-1-me@bonfacemunyoki.com> References: <20210508204124.38500-1-me@bonfacemunyoki.com> M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Received-SPF: pass client-ip=64.147.123.19; envelope-from=me@bonfacemunyoki.com; helo=wout3-smtp.messagingengine.com X-Spam_score_int: -26 X-Spam_score: -2.7 X-Spam_bar: -- X-Spam_report: (-2.7 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, RCVD_IN_DNSWL_LOW=-0.7, RCVD_IN_MSPIKE_H4=0.001, RCVD_IN_MSPIKE_WL=0.001, SPF_HELO_PASS=-0.001, SPF_PASS=-0.001, URIBL_SBL_A=0.1 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: "Guix-patches" X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1620506551;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-cc: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=Rp9bi8kFI3nw4zfK035oQgYfbuuaAHuez/7Is2nSRPw=; b=usEnzmP42aqhRQMWTSShNx46wtxrg+ZGAA5q8P2AxaNcyRa2YZrTcLTizo1ObOEaPhOz6T WIYdyk+OZ4eqmRDmpBIiOaDZVo8VbVjbplcmPJ7CYEk9bQ5B17u3LPgLXbkMxkwHSQMyke 2zOy0PZ/1uYPFo5CDU73d9OSb73Afai46/Tet+n+uAVtKCPh6TUfY8NU4KoEA1De0icMIe DQJ1sgdo5CuY1TruS8XgpJGMtYNVaIuHfG1LPuFtujAGIBLZ7HStlqkID7pyLrwQvMVR5M HNB7DLM339zCZNJ1K9TntrRAJsF1N0p8Qz0rXroI50wYqjY+fF1latOMW6O8AQ==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1620506551; a=rsa-sha256; cv=none; b=W9WswjXnvBTMbTM0c8T1kW113SzFlJlWRncE4hXhhwxtNoy6vLH1zAtIrIzwkWi3cdO2B8 HeC9OI/IL8MpH9/xlPeeWJQHn2FHp0aTsuFWoaH49QRuw2u55gwNr2y8JkCRFTdcFg5G0d 5BkQFhdpdBlQi1E7MINkb9mlNFj0LimZ+FypR4PRvKydkw36nsmS9HhwDY9zRz47Brj4BR 183ENrNHbKqSj6dNH2Qc5P4FK7G0b52hw4hZwdqz9eHuOMd7ePfoD83S3Jpfeh+Vs2Xvko PJCmS8UEepBClNJ66P/rp5M73hwKCt0SbmJZHz1Mk+K2gumg/IJpB5J4wEz2Ng==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=bonfacemunyoki.com header.s=fm2 header.b="Xbp/I3Yt";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m2 header.b="R/4mFNT+"; dmarc=none;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Spam-Score: -0.45 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=bonfacemunyoki.com header.s=fm2 header.b="Xbp/I3Yt"; dkim=fail ("headers rsa verify failed") header.d=messagingengine.com header.s=fm2 header.b="R/4mFNT+"; dmarc=none;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Queue-Id: 674D417450 X-Spam-Score: -0.45 X-Migadu-Scanner: scn0.migadu.com X-TUID: Y2m1TZRSFoLj * gnu/packages/databases.scm (python-sqlalchemy-stubs): New variable. --- gnu/packages/databases.scm | 26 ++++++++++++++++++++++++++ 1 file changed, 26 insertions(+) diff --git a/gnu/packages/databases.scm b/gnu/packages/databases.scm index 2777293200..54cf394d17 100644 --- a/gnu/packages/databases.scm +++ b/gnu/packages/databases.scm @@ -50,6 +50,7 @@ ;;; Copyright © 2021 Greg Hogan ;;; Copyright © 2021 David Larsson ;;; Copyright © 2021 Pjotr Prins +;;; Copyright © 2021 Bonface Munyoki Kilyungi ;;; ;;; This file is part of GNU Guix. ;;; @@ -114,6 +115,7 @@ #:use-module (gnu packages popt) #:use-module (gnu packages protobuf) #:use-module (gnu packages python) + #:use-module (gnu packages python-check) #:use-module (gnu packages python-crypto) #:use-module (gnu packages python-science) #:use-module (gnu packages python-web) @@ -2926,6 +2928,30 @@ simple and Pythonic domain language.") (define-public python2-sqlalchemy (package-with-python2 python-sqlalchemy)) +(define-public python-sqlalchemy-stubs + (package + (name "python-sqlalchemy-stubs") + (version "0.4") + (source + (origin + (method url-fetch) + (uri (pypi-uri "sqlalchemy-stubs" version)) + (sha256 + (base32 + "1bppjmv7v7m0q8gwg791pgxbx4ay7mna0zq204pn9vw28kfxcrf6")))) + (build-system python-build-system) + (propagated-inputs + `(("python-mypy" ,python-mypy) + ("python-typing-extensions" + ,python-typing-extensions))) + (home-page + "https://github.com/dropbox/sqlalchemy-stubs") + (synopsis "SQLAlchemy stubs and mypy plugin") + (description "This package contains type stubs and a mypy plugin to +provide more precise static types and type inference for SQLAlchemy +framework.") + (license license:expat))) + (define-public python-sqlalchemy-utils (package (name "python-sqlalchemy-utils") -- 2.31.1